Cowboy Hero + Historical Romance

The rugged cowboy, with his broad shoulders and sun-kissed skin, rides into a world filled with the romance of yesteryear, igniting a fiery connection that transcends time. In a setting where dusty trails and sprawling ranches are the backdrop, the cowboy hero’s blend of strength and vulnerability brings an electrifying tension to historical romances. The clash between his untamed spirit and societal expectations creates an intense emotional landscape, compelling readers to explore how love flourishes in the face of tradition and hardship.

Picture a spirited woman, torn between her duty to her family and the undeniable pull of her heart, as she meets the brooding cowboy at a county fair. Their eyes lock across the bustling crowd, and in that moment, the weight of their circumstances fades away. Whether they’re dancing beneath the stars or sharing secrets around a crackling fire, their chemistry sizzles against the backdrop of a world that tries to keep them apart. With various levels of heat and unique character dynamics, these tales offer a rich experience-one that celebrates passion and resilience in the face of historical constraints.
